We are looking for you who want to be part of our wonderful team at Willys Staffanstorp Rondellen! As an e-commerce coordinator, you are responsible for ensuring that our customers' orders are picked, packed, and made ready for pickup at our Pickup Station. You are an important part of the store team that ensures our customers have the best shopping experience. Here’s a bit more about the position:
- You handle and participate in the daily e-commerce operations in the store, such as planning and coordinating picking, packing, and delivery of e-commerce goods.
- In collaboration with the store managers, you plan the day's tasks and the work ahead. You handle both planned and unforeseen events. This is a great entry-level job for you who want to try a role that involves leadership, structure, and planning.
- You are a spider in the store's e-commerce web and are the contact person for customer service and carriers.
- You analyze, follow up, and drive e-commerce issues together with your immediate manager.
- You are part of the grocery team and participate in the daily work with sales, product display, follow-up, and coordination.
- You assist our customers and meet them with knowledge, sensitivity, and a big smile.
- You help our customers at the checkout or at one of our other checkout options.
